About this piece

A suite of five distinct character pieces that showcase Ravel's mastery of keyboard harmony and varied musical imagery. Each piece explores a different facet of the piano's resonance and sonority.

Teacher notes

The core difficulty lies in 'voicing'—extracting the melodic lines from complex, thick impressionistic textures.

Frequently asked questions

How hard is Miroirs by Maurice Ravel?

Miroirs is rated Henle level 8 of 9 — concert repertoire, roughly diploma level. In the RCM system it corresponds to about level 10.

What level do I need to play Miroirs?

You should be comfortable at Henle level 8 — meaning you can already play level 7–8 pieces cleanly. Learning it one level early is possible as a stretch piece, but more than that usually leads to months of frustration.

How long is Miroirs?

A typical performance of Miroirs lasts about 25 minutes.
